#c69004 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#c69004 is composed of 77.6% red, 56.5%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 27.3% magenta, 98% yellow and 22.4% black. It has a hue angle of 43.3 degrees, a saturation of 96% and a lightness of 39.6%. #c69004 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ff08 with #8d2100. Closest websafe color is: #cc9900.

#c69004 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#c69004 has RGB values of R:198, G:144, B:4 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.27, Y:0.98, K:0.22. Its decimal value is 13012996.

Shades and Tints of #c69004
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060400 is the darkest color, while #fffbf2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#c69004
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#696761 is the less saturated color, while #c69004 is the most saturated one.
